    • Welcome to today’s lesson, where we will explore how to accurately quote and paraphrase text to support understanding and interpretation. Using an excerpt from The Lion, the Witch and the Wardrobe, you will practice identifying key details, distinguishing between quoting and paraphrasing, and using both strategies to answer questions clearly and thoughtfully.

      By the end of this session, you will be able to explain what a text says directly and support your inferences with evidence. Please stay engaged, follow the instructions carefully, and be prepared to reflect on the text using your own words and the author’s. Let’s begin.

    • By the end of this lesson, you will be able to:

      • Understand the difference between quoting and paraphrasing.

      • Accurately quote or paraphrase a text.

      • Use evidence to make inferences and explain your answers.
